Default What the hell is wrong with my car now?

at highway speeds..everything is fine until i accelerate and then let off the gas...car feels like it goes to one side for a second!!!!what gives??

any input on this? (P.S I also have the shaking problem in the rear..is there a connection?)

Yeah, first guess would be a tire that needs to be balanced and a tire pressure problem. S02's have a stiff sidewall so even at low pressure, they can appear to be full. I would check them all with a guage.

Anyway.. what they said. S2k is very sensitive to changes in tire pressure. If that doesn't fix it, could be uneven tire wear, or alignment problem.
